#924c12 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#924c12 is composed of 57.3% red, 29.8%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.9% magenta, 87.7%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 27.2 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 32.2%. #924c12 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9824 with #250000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#924c12

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060301 is the darkest color, while #fef8f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#924c12

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535251 is the less saturated color, while #9f4b05 is the most saturated one.
